Matthew Johnson, a financial advisor since 1999, shares practical insights in The Capitalized Retirement to help readers maximize their retirement savings and overcome the fear of outliving their savings. He advises switching from growth-oriented to income-oriented investment strategies and identifies the pitfalls of common myths and financial planners' incentives. The book emphasizes the importance of having more income than you need for a stress-free retirement.

Matthew Johnson, a financial services industry advisor since 1999, has extensive experience in putting clients first. He inherited this belief from his father, also a financial advisor. Johnson understands the challenges faced by individuals in retirement, particularly concerning financial security. In his book, "The Capitalized Retirement," he assumes the role of a personal advisor, providing practical strategies for maximizing retirement savings. The key lies in transitioning from growth-oriented to income-oriented investment strategies.

The primary concern of retirees is whether they will have sufficient savings for a comfortable retirement. With increasing life expectancies, retirees are increasingly questioning whether they will outlive their savings. In "The Capitalized Retirement," Matthew Johnson offers valuable insights from his decades of experience as a financial advisor. He not only guides readers through the fundamentals of retirement investing but also identifies potential pitfalls along the way. One such myth is the notion that investing in the stock market is the sole valid option for savvy investors. Johnson debunks this misconception based on his extensive knowledge and understanding of the marketplace. He helps readers recognize why many financial planners may not always prioritize their clients' best interests, often focusing on incentives that benefit themselves rather than depleting investors' principals. This phenomenon, known as the "disease of ease," has led some financial planners to deviate from their clients' best interests, succumbing to the temptation of convenience.

While retirement can be overwhelming for many, Johnson takes on the role of a personal guide, offering practical solutions and insights. He empowers readers to make informed decisions and navigate the complexities of retirement planning. By emphasizing the importance of income-oriented investment strategies and exposing the flaws in traditional financial advice, "The Capitalized Retirement" provides a valuable resource for individuals seeking to secure a prosperous and fulfilling retirement.
